Here is a list of some events happened on May 5. For full list please click on the link above.
Date | Event |
---|---|
1864 | American Civil War: The Battle of the Wilderness begins in Spotsylvania County. |
1961 | Alan Shepard becomes the first American to travel into outer space, on a sub-orbital flight. |
1964 | The Council of Europe declares May 5 as Europe Day. |
1955 | The General Treaty, by which France, Britain and the United States recognize the sovereignty of West Germany, comes into effect. |
1609 | Daimyō (Lord) Shimazu Tadatsune of the Satsuma Domain in southern Kyūshū, Japan, completes his successful invasion of the Ryūkyū Kingdom in Okinawa. |
1972 | Alitalia Flight 112 crashes into Mount Longa near Palermo, Sicily, killing all 115 aboard, making it the deadliest single-aircraft disaster in Italy. |
1936 | Italian troops occupy Addis Ababa, Ethiopia. |
1494 | On his second voyage to the New World, Christopher Columbus sights Jamaica, landing at Discovery Bay and declares Jamaica the property of the Spanish crown. |
1835 | The first railway in continental Europe opens between Brussels and Mechelen. |
1980 | Operation Nimrod: The British Special Air Service storms the Iranian embassy in London after a six-day siege. |
